The National Academy of Television Arts and Sciences today revealed the winners of its third annual Children’s & Family Emmy Awards, the stand-alone competition that honors creativity and innovation in children’s entertainment.
See the full list below. Winners will pick up their statuettes during the 2024 Children’s & Family Emmys ceremony on March 15 in Los Angeles.
